Output ab29f18e92c56f94dd5abebaf73664c93545c96aa87e1732fffc5b5094c267a9:0

value
32828776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830012ae475e5dc78c8ddaca8e6dc5bff806d896 OP_EQUAL
address
MKqpqdW3oMwfm8AB6CxJwHqLCTN6jdPvcH
transaction
ab29f18e92c56f94dd5abebaf73664c93545c96aa87e1732fffc5b5094c267a9
spent
true